How they compare
Aruba currently reports 20.0% against 16.4% in Cameroon, a difference of 3.6%.
That makes Aruba's figure about 1.2 times Cameroon's.
Across all 16 years both countries report, Aruba has been ahead every year.
Aruba ranks 140th and Cameroon ranks 142nd of 189 countries.
Aruba has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Aruba | Cameroon |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 38.2% | 5.6% | 32.6% | Aruba |
| 2010s | 32.5% | 12.6% | 19.8% | Aruba |
| 2020s | 20.0% | 16.4% | 3.6% | Aruba |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
